What is Bill Gavin known for?

Bill Gavin is known for acting, with notable roles in films such as 'Jubilee' (2000), 'The Last Tattoo' (1994), and 'Clay, Smeddum and Greenden' (1976) as Doctor.

What genres does Bill Gavin's filmography span?

Bill Gavin's filmography spans the genres of Drama, Crime, Comedy, and TV Movie.

What era or decades does Bill Gavin's work cover?

Bill Gavin's work covers from 1976 to 2000, with the most-active decade being the 1990s.

How extensive is Bill Gavin's filmography?

Bill Gavin has a total of 7 films listed in his filmography.
